* the compiler no longer emits efficiency notes for (FUNCALL X)
when the type of X is uncertain under default optimization
settings.
+ * fixed bug 276: mutating a binding of a specialized parameter to a
+ method to something that is not TYPEP the specializer is now
+ possible.
* fixed bugs 45d and 118: DOUBLE-FLOAT[-NEGATIVE]-EPSILON now
exhibit the required behaviour on the x86 platform. (thanks to
Peter van Eynde, Eric Marsden and Bruno Haible)
* fixed another bug in backquote printing: no more destructive
modification of the form's list structure. (reported by Brian
Downing)
+ * fixed bug in INTERRUPT-THREAD: pin the function, so that it cannot
+ move between its address being taken and the call to
+ interrupt_thread, fixing a crashing race condition.
+ * the SB-POSIX contrib implementation has been adjusted so that it
+ no longer exhibits ridiculously poor performance when constructing
+ instances corresponding to C structs.
